Role OverviewLead the design and development of web applications or software, collaborating with cross-functional teams to deliver integrated solutions. Work primarily remotely, with proximity to project and client teams in San Diego, CA or DC Metro Area.
What You Will Do
Design and develop full-stack web applications, lead cloud-native engineering, and implement testing and optimization strategies. Collaborate with teams, create documentation, and engage with customers.
Why It Might Be a Fit
This role requires a strong understanding of software architecture, design principles, and coding best practices. You will work with a team to deliver integrated solutions and engage with customers to improve services and outcomes.
Requirements
- Proven experience in application development
- Strong understanding of software architecture, design principles, and coding best practices
- In-depth knowledge of programming languages such as Java, Javascript, Python, or others relevant to application development
- Experience with front-end web technologies such as Node.js, Angular, React
- Strong Proficiency in cloud platforms such as AWS, Azure, or Google Cloud
- Strong software engineering skills with an emphasis on writing clean, modular, and maintainable code
- Familiarity with version control systems (e.g., Git) and collaborative development workflows
- Excellent problem-solving and critical-thinking skills
- Effective communication skills and ability to work in a collaborative team environment
Benefits
- Remote work
- Security clearance
- Training sessions and knowledge transfer activities
- Comprehensive documentation
- Continuous learning and innovation opportunities
]]>